D. Definition of Spam

Spam is unsolicited E-mail sent in bulk. Any promotion, information or solicitation that is sent to a person via e-mail without their prior consent, where there is no pre-existing relationship between the sender and the recipient, is spam.

E. Examples of Spam

Any e-mail message sent to a recipient who had previously signed up to receive newsletters, services information or any other type of bulk E-mail but later opted-out by indicating to the sender that they did not want to receive additional E-mail, then that E-mail is spam.
Any e-mail message sent to recipients who have had no prior association with the organization or did not agree to be e-mailed by the organization is spam.
Any e-mail message that is sent to a recipient without a way for a person to opt-out or request that future mailings not be sent to them, is spam.
Any E-mail message that does not have a valid E-mail address in the From Line is spam.
Any E-mail message that contains any false or misleading information in the header, subject line, or message itself is spam.
Any E-mail message that promotes an adult web site is spam, unless the recipient has specifically requested information from that web site.
Any message sent to e-mail addresses that have been harvested from web sites, newsgroups, or other areas of the Internet is spam.
